Annotation

At the present stage of studying the genetic grape resources, the DNA profiles addit the traditional ampelographic descriptions, agrobiological and economic characteristics of varieties and serve as a basis for reliable identification of genotypes, therefore, in order to solve the priority tasks of vine breeding, it is necessary to mobilize and conserve the genetic resources, with the creation of an electronic database. Ampelographic collections are very important in the preservation and use of the gene grape pool, in these collections the work is constantly carried out to introduce varieties, to study of their agrobiological, phonological and economic features, to identify the promising ones from them, and to select the donors for use in breeding work in order to obtain the new competitive varieties. In the Anapa ampelographic collection with the participation of the laboratory of variety study and preservation of the grape gene pool of NCFSCHVW the DNA-certification of grape varieties is carried out, a collection database has been created. Among the features of the software platform there is the search for samples in the database for a number of parameters, displaying a common list of samples and displaying the detailed information for each variety separately. Services for calculating and analyzing of agro-biological and phenological observations data, analyzing the safety of buds after wintering of plants according to bushplaces in an ampelocollection have been realized. The DNA certification was carried out for the grape varieties of AZESVW breeding the branch of the FSBSI NCFSCHVW (10 varieties), the varieties of the FSBSI NCFSCHVW (9 varieties) and 4 well-known European varieties, which will be integrated into a united database. The obtained DNA-passports of varieties in practice can be effectively applied to determine the clean varieties in the planting material and in the grapes orchards, to define the parental forms of the sample, as well as in the disputed questions of the variety authorship.

Annotation

As a result of long-term observations on the Anapa ampelographic collection, a comparatively large group of white tech-nical varieties of grapes was singled out for indicators of productivity, resistance to diseases and pests, and the quality of the wine products obtained. Periodically recurring abrupt changes in abiotic factors made it possible to more strictly assess the possibilities of varieties of grapes of various origins and assess their frost resistance, drought re-sistance and productivity under abiotic stress conditions. The grape varieties were studied in a grafted open culture, on the rootstock of Berlandieri x Riparia Kober 5BB. Formation spiral cordon ZS-1. The planting scheme is 3.5 x 2.0 m. The cultivation technology is generally accepted for the Southern zone of industrial viticulture in the Russian Federation. The indicators of the bush load, fruitfulness, growth vigor and the degree of ripening of annual shoots are determined according to well known methods and methodological recommendations. In the period from 2001 to 2010, Arabaklo, Bakator white, Golden Autumn and Pollux were identified as promising for introduction into production and use in breeding as sources of a number of economically valuable traits. The article describes the descriptions and characteristics of these grape varieties in comparison with the standard the classic French Aligotte, obtained as a result of observations on the Anapa am-phelographic collection in the period from 2007 to 2017. Technical varieties of Araboublo, Bakator white, Golden Autumn and Pollux should be recommended for industrial use, which will expand the boundaries of sustainable grape production in the region. Varieties of Araboublo, Bakator white and Golden Autumn, as representatives of the species Vitis vinifera, can be used in breeding as sources of frost and drought resistance for the production of high-quality complex-resistant varieties of grapes.
